What are skin tags?
Skin tags are made of loose collagen fibres and blood vessels surrounded by skin. Collagen is a type of protein found throughout the body. They’re very common, harmless, and can vary in colour and size. Typically found in areas where skin repeatedly rubs against itself, such as armpits, groin, neck and eyelids.
Skin tags often get confused with warts. the NHS have provided the following information to help you distinguish between them:
- smooth and soft (warts tend to be rougher with an irregular surface)
- knobbly and hang off the skin (warts are usually slightly raised or flat)
- not contagious (warts spread very easily, so a sudden outbreak or cluster of growths is more likely to be warts)
Skin tags present no medical threat and don’t usually cause pain or discomfort. However, they can make people feel self-conscious and can hurt if caught on clothing. They can also cause issues for men when shaving.
Laser Treatment for Removal
There are various ways skin tags can be removed; one being Laser. The pixelated laser divides light into multiple fractions that go as deep as 3mm into the dermis, heating the skin from beneath and delivering a controlled dermal wound healing.
